SINCLAIR, Sharon Lynn

2022-03-29


Sharon Lynn Sinclair, predeceased by her parents Sheila and Andrew Sinclair, her brother Kent Sinclair, as well as her daughter Leah Lathrop, survived by siblings Tom (Carole) Sinclair and Stephanie (Peter) Minardi and John Lathrop father of Alexis, Victoria and Leah Lathrop, passed away peacefully on Tuesday, March 29, at her residence.

Sharon first started a banking career for the Royal Bank, then transitioned to bookkeeping for numerous years at the L&M Grocery Store in Fergus. She also enjoyed catering and being active in numerous churches, Fergus, ON, Bridgewater, NS, and Dryden, ON. Her faith and love of life were obvious to all who knew her.

She is survived by family, remembered by her daughters Alexis (Lester) and Victoria (Yeb) and her grandsons Austin and Aidan; granddaughters Naomi, Isabelle and Eva; numerous nephews, nieces and cousins. Sharon made friends wherever she went, Bridgewater, NS, for some years, as well as Dryden, ON. She was an amazing mother, aunt, and friend; the world has lost a wonderful woman.

The family wishes to say a big thank you for all the support Sharon received during the last few months from neighbours, friends, family, doctors and nurses.

There was a small celebration of life for family only on Saturday, April 30, 2022, at St James Anglican Church in Fergus, ON. Donations to the Cancer Society and St James Anglican Church would be much appreciated.
